The evidence presented during the two-week trial in United States District Court which included Punjabi language wiretap calls, Punjabi-speaking witnesses and a money laundering expert showed that Singh participated in a hawala conspiracy that was moving money generated from drug sales in Canada to the United States to pay for multi-kilogram drug shipments that were purchased in Los Angeles and then routed back to Canada for distribution. FinCEN advisory 2010-A011, issued on September 1, 2010, reminds financial institutions of this as follows: As a type of Money Services Business (MSB) and specifically, as a type of money transmitter, IVTS may legally operate in the United States, so long as they abide by applicable state and federal laws. The Financial Crimes Enforcement Network (FinCEN) advisory 33, issued in March of 2003, references hawala as one of several Informal Value Transfer Systems (IVTS) operating throughout the world. A hawaladar with a legitimate business, that has international activity, can simply commingle hawala funds with his normal receipts. The Hawala broker often runs a legitimate business in addition to the financial services he offers and has a business contact, a friend or a relative in this city/country. Hawala or hewala ( Arabic: awla, meaning transfer or sometimes trust ), also known as havaleh in Persian, [1] and xawala or xawilaad [2] in Somali, is a popular and informal value transfer system based on the performance and honour of a huge network of money brokers (known as hawaladars ).
